This is a simple buttery tomato pasta with cheese, ready in about 15 minutes. It works because the flavor is mild, the ingredient list is short, and you can adjust it without making a separate meal for every person at the table.
A kid-friendly quick pasta recipe that actually gets eaten
Start by boiling 8 ounces of pasta in salted water. Small shapes like shells, rotini, or elbows usually go over best with kids because they are easy to scoop and hold sauce well.
While the pasta cooks, warm 2 tablespoons of butter in a large pan over medium heat. Stir in 1 cup of tomato sauce and 1/4 cup of heavy cream or whole milk. Add a small pinch of garlic powder, a pinch of salt, and a little shredded mozzarella or Parmesan. Stir until smooth.
Drain the pasta and add it straight to the sauce. If it looks too thick, use a splash of pasta water to loosen it up. Toss until everything is coated, then serve warm.
Why this quick pasta recipe works for families
The biggest reason this recipe works is flexibility. If your child loves plain pasta, pull some out before adding sauce. If they need protein, mix in shredded chicken or a few turkey meatballs. If you want to sneak in vegetables, blend a little cooked carrot or cauliflower into the sauce. Most kids will not notice if the texture stays smooth.
It is also easy on cleanup, which matters on busy weeknights. One pot for pasta, one pan for sauce, and dinner is done without turning the kitchen upside down.
Easy swaps if your pantry is running low
No cream? Use a little extra butter and a spoonful of cream cheese. No mozzarella? Mild cheddar can work, though the sauce will taste a bit sharper. No tomato sauce? Even a few spoonfuls of marinara will do the job.
